Gene Autry is back in the saddle again as an undercover detective in this action-packed Western complete with a showdown. Gene poses as a jailbird to wangle the truth from a boy (Dick Jones) suspected of stealing an Army payroll. When the youngster escapes from lockup and rejoins his family's medicine show, intrigue is in the wind as Gene tries to solve the mystery of the missing money and to save the lad from a vicious mob. Pat Buttram co-stars.

George J. Lewis was born on December 10, 1903 in Guadalajara, Jalisco, Mexico. He was an actor, known for Radar Patrol vs. Spy King (1949), Malice in the Palace (1949) and Zorros Black Whip (1944). He was married to Mary Louise Lohman. He died on December 8, 1995 in Rancho Santa Fe, California, USA.
